Weather – EASTER ISLAND

The climate of Easter Island (Rapa Nui) is subtropical, warm and humid in summer and mild in winter, since the average temperatures ranges from 23 °) in the period from January to March, to 18 °C in the period from July to September (the island is situated in the Southern Hemisphere, where the seasons are reversed to those in Europe or North America). During winter, sometimes the night temperature may drop slightly below 10 °C from June to August.

Day 2: Easter Island

Day 2: Easter Island

Breakfast at the hotel.

Day excursion to mysteriously interesting sites. Road to Rano Raraku volcano to meet the Ahu Vaihu, an altar with eight moaï overthrown and their caps (pukaos) that rolled on the ground to anchor it. On the way to the rugged coastline south of the island, we will also see the site Ahu Akahanga, considered the necropolis of King Hotu Matua for these royal links, and Ahu Tongariki where 12 moai were almost totally destroyed in the chaos of tribal wars and tsunami in 1960 .

Box Lunch. A packed lunch will be served near the place where the moai were carved on rocks of Rano Raraku volcano. Then, going back by the same route northward, arriving at Ahu Te Pito Kura, site of the largest moai (almost 9.98 meters high and 82 tons in weight) and whose name means “navel of the world”. Finally we get to the Anakena beach where we will find 2 platforms: Ahu Nau Nau and the Ahu Ature Huki.

Return to the hotel. Dinner & Overnight at hotel.

Day 3: Easter Island

Day 3: Easter Island

Breakfast at the hotel.

In the morning departure to visit the Ahu Akivi, platform of 7 moai restored. According to the legend, this seven statues represents the first explores arrived to the Rapa Nui Island, sent by the king Hotu Matua.

We cannot end the excursion without visiting the Puna Pau quarry, where the Pukao or hats of the moai, where sculpted.

Departure to visit the ceremonial site of Tahai with 3 platforms, the Ahu with its statues re-erected. In this site is also located the only moai with eyes.

We will also have the occasion to visit one boathouse, a stone henhouse and a dock completely built in stone.

Day 4: Easter Island

Day 4: Easter Island

Breakfast at the hotel.

In the morning we will go up the Rano Kau volcano, from where you will get and splendid view of the island, the coast and the Hanga Roa town. The second viewpoint that we will visit will let us appreciate the crater of the Rano Kau volcano, with the lagoon of more than one and a half kilometers of diameter. We reach the Orongo ceremonial village, where rituals of the Bird Man took place: “Tangata Manu”. Visit of the Ahu Vinapu which architecture reminds us the pre-Inca constructions.
